VCBeat recently learned that Innovmab Therapeutics (Shanghai) Co., Ltd. ("Innovmab Therapeutics") has completed an angel+ round of financing from Dandelion (Shenzhen) Pharmaceutical Venture Capital Co., Ltd. The funds will be used to deeply integrate proteomics technology platforms with drug development, creating multiple ADC pipelines with best-in-class potential.
Innovmab Therapeutics is a company driven by omics big data to develop targeted drugs and novel precision medical decision-making tools. Based on proteomics technology and various highly clinically relevant disease model libraries, including PDX/PDO, the company has established a distinctive drug R&D decision-making tool platform. By leveraging highly clinically relevant big data and deep biological insights obtained through AI computation, Innovmab accelerates the high-success-rate development of its proprietary new drug pipeline and IVD products. This technological platform provides rational decision-making data support for multiple key stages of new drug development, including target discovery, drug mechanism of action, patient selection, clinical trial design, determination of interim/surrogate endpoints in clinical studies, combination therapy development, clinical medication decision support, and drug indication expansion.

Combination therapy is one of the most important development directions for ADC drugs. Through combination therapy, the effective dose of ADC can be significantly reduced, side effects minimized, and the therapeutic window expanded.
This technology platform will also be applied to the development of precise diagnostic and therapeutic markers for diseases. Complex diseases such as cancer are often caused by multi-gene abnormalities and exhibit high heterogeneity, making biomarkers play a crucial role in medical decision-making. However, there is still a severe lack of clinically available precise biomarkers. Major reasons contributing to the difficulty in developing effective biomarkers include the lack of drug efficacy-related clinical models, insufficient systematic efficacy data support, and low result comparability due to the absence of standardized high-quality data. To address this significant unmet clinical need, Innovmab Therapeutics' organoid multi-omics platform uses AI algorithms to establish relationships between drug efficacy and multi-omics data, enabling the screening of more precise combinations of drug efficacy markers and providing clinicians with evidence for precise medication decisions. Its core LDT product under development can simultaneously detect the activity of eight drug efficacy-related protein factors, guiding the use of targeted drugs based on the HER signaling pathway, covering various indications including breast cancer, non-small cell lung cancer, colorectal cancer, gastric cancer, pancreatic cancer, ovarian cancer, and melanoma.This product can be developed into an IVD kit for multi-target detection of tumor pathology slides with a completely new concept.
